Soundgarden is a legendary American rock band that helped define the grunge movement of the late 1980s and early 1990s. Known for their powerful vocals and heavy guitar riffs, Soundgarden continues to influence rock musicians worldwide.

Did You Know?
Soundgarden was the first grunge band to sign to a major label when they joined A&M Records in 1988, predating Nirvana and Pearl Jam’s label deals.

Q:When and where was Soundgarden formed?
A:Soundgarden formed in Seattle, Washington, in 1984.
Soundgarden began in Seattle’s emerging alternative rock scene in 1984, becoming one of the earliest bands associated with the grunge movement that would later define the city’s music identity globally.
Q:Who were Soundgarden's founding members?
A:Chris Cornell, Kim Thayil, and Hiro Yamamoto founded the band.
Vocalist Chris Cornell, guitarist Kim Thayil, and bassist Hiro Yamamoto created Soundgarden, blending heavy metal and punk influences into their early sound, which helped shape the Seattle grunge aesthetic of the mid-1980s.
